3m -70m Moderate track From the car park, this walk heads to the service trail gate parallel with the road (approximately in line with the end of the grassy median strip) and then onto the trail behind. The track passes through the heath for a while until it nears the cliff edge and narrows.

Bushwalking trail: Porters Pass and Colliers Causeway Loop Known as The Grotto, Fairy Grotto and in the past as Harpers Cave, this is an incredibly picturesque swimming hole and waterfall, inside a narrow slot canyon. The waterfall drops into a deep pool at the end of the long canyon.

Porters Pass Recreational Reserve Summary: A short but scenic bushwalk, the Walls Ledge Loop offers views of the Kanimbla Valley. Combine with Colliers Causeway and Porters Pass for a longer and more challenging loop. Trailhead: Centennial Glen Carpark at end of Centennial Glen Road Public transport options: Train 1.7km walk from Blackheath station

Bushwalking trail: Porters Pass and Colliers Causeway Loop Along Porters Pass at the top of the cliff-line is Lamberts Lookout. It's named after Lambertius Vandenburg, a signwriter at the Blue Mountains Council, with the naming being a farewell gesture from the council when Lambert retired in 1987.
